Overview of Vitamin D and Bone Health

Strong bones are the foundation of a healthy body, but many overlook the essential role of a key nutrient. This nutrient is critical for calcium absorption, which is necessary for maintaining strong bones. Without it, the body struggles to utilize calcium effectively, leading to potential health issues.

Understanding Calcium Absorption

Calcium is vital for bone formation, but its absorption depends on this nutrient. When calcium is consumed, the nutrient ensures it is absorbed in the intestines. Without sufficient levels, calcium cannot be utilized properly, weakening bones over time.

The Role of Vitamin D in Bone Maintenance

This nutrient undergoes a fascinating transformation in the body. It is first activated in the liver and then in the kidneys, converting into its active form. This active form helps regulate calcium levels, ensuring bones remain strong and healthy.

Research shows that women, in particular, are at higher risk of deficiencies. This can lead to conditions like osteoporosis, where bones become fragile and prone to fractures. Ensuring adequate levels of this nutrient is especially important for women’s long-term health.

Vitamin D for bone strength Malaysia

In Malaysia, the prevalence of a certain nutrient deficiency is surprisingly high, despite abundant sunlight. Local studies reveal that many Malaysians struggle to maintain adequate levels of this essential nutrient, which plays a critical role in calcium absorption. Without it, the body cannot effectively utilize calcium, increasing the risk of bone-related conditions.

Local Health Trends and Research

Recent research highlights a concerning trend: a significant portion of the population, including women and adolescents, face deficiencies. For instance, a study in Kuala Lumpur found that 71.3% of Malay women and 12.2% of Chinese women had insufficient levels. This disparity underscores the need for targeted health interventions.

Cultural practices, such as traditional clothing that limits sun exposure, contribute to these challenges. Additionally, modern lifestyles often involve limited outdoor activities, further reducing natural nutrient synthesis. These factors combined create a unique health landscape in Malaysia.

Epidemiology of Vitamin D Deficiency in Malaysia

Recent studies reveal a concerning trend in Malaysia’s health landscape. Despite its tropical climate, many Malaysians face deficiencies in a crucial nutrient. This issue spans various demographics, from children to older adults, and poses significant public health challenges.

Epidemiology of Nutrient Deficiency in Malaysia

Prevalence Among Different Demographics

Research shows that deficiencies are widespread across different groups. For instance, a study in Kuala Lumpur found that 67.4% of teachers had insufficient levels. Among them, 80.9% were of Indian descent, 75.6% Malay, and 25.1% Chinese. This highlights disparities based on ethnicity.

Children and adolescents are also affected. A large study found that 78.9% of 12 to 13-year-olds had low levels, with 1.5% severely deficient. Another survey revealed that 47.5% of children aged 4 to 12 had insufficient levels, with girls more affected than boys.

Key Findings from Malaysian Studies

Several studies underscore the link between deficiencies and bone health. For example, 82.7% of menopausal women in Kuala Lumpur had low levels, increasing their risk of fractures. Similarly, 90.4% of pregnant women in Selangor were found to have insufficient levels, which can impact both maternal and fetal health.

Dietary intake plays a crucial role. A study noted that only 24% of adults aged 50–59 consumed full cream milk, a source of this nutrient. Urban populations also showed higher prevalence rates compared to rural areas, likely due to lifestyle factors.

  • Deficiencies are prevalent across all age groups and ethnicities.
  • Women, especially pregnant and menopausal individuals, are at higher risk.
  • Dietary habits and urban lifestyles contribute to the issue.
  • Low levels are linked to reduced bone density and increased fracture risks.

Nutritional Sources of Vitamin D for Optimal Bone Health

A balanced diet plays a crucial role in maintaining strong bones and overall health. Ensuring adequate intake of key nutrients through food is essential for preventing deficiencies and supporting long-term wellness. This section explores natural and fortified food sources that can help maintain optimal levels of this vital nutrient.

Foods Naturally Rich in Vitamin D

Certain foods are naturally high in this nutrient, making them excellent additions to a healthy diet. Fatty fish like salmon, mackerel, and sardines are among the best sources. Just one serving of salmon can provide a significant portion of the daily requirement.

Eggs, particularly the yolks, are another great option. Dairy products such as milk, cheese, and yogurt also contribute to nutrient intake. For those who prefer plant-based options, mushrooms exposed to sunlight are a unique source.

Fortified Foods and Dietary Guidelines

Fortified foods are an effective way to boost daily nutrient intake. Many cereals, orange juices, and plant-based milk alternatives are enriched with this nutrient. These products are especially helpful for individuals with dietary restrictions or limited sun exposure.

Dietary guidelines recommend incorporating a mix of natural and fortified foods into meals. For example, starting the day with fortified cereal and milk can provide a nutrient-rich breakfast. Pairing eggs with fortified orange juice is another simple yet effective strategy.

The Influence of Lifestyle and Culture on Vitamin D Status in Malaysia

Cultural practices and modern lifestyles in Malaysia significantly influence nutrient levels, impacting overall health. Despite the country’s sunny climate, many factors contribute to widespread deficiencies. Understanding these influences is key to addressing the issue effectively.

Lifestyle and Culture Impact on Nutrient Levels

Traditional Clothing and Reduced Sunlight

Traditional clothing in Malaysia often covers most of the skin, limiting exposure to sunlight. This practice, while culturally significant, reduces the body’s ability to produce essential nutrients. Studies show that individuals who wear such clothing have lower levels of this nutrient compared to those with more skin exposure.

For example, research indicates that girls, who often wear traditional attire, have significantly lower nutrient levels than boys. This highlights how cultural practices can inadvertently affect health outcomes, especially among younger individuals.

Modern Lifestyle Factors

Urban living and indoor work environments further exacerbate the issue. Many Malaysians spend most of their time indoors, reducing opportunities for natural sunlight exposure. Modern habits, such as increased screen time and reduced outdoor activities, also play a role.

Even among young *year old* individuals, deficiencies are prevalent. A study found that 78.9% of adolescents aged 12 to 13 had low nutrient levels. This underscores the need for lifestyle adjustments to support better health.

Comparative Analysis with Global Bone Health Research

Understanding global trends in bone health reveals unique challenges faced by Malaysia. While many countries grapple with deficiencies, the local context presents distinct patterns influenced by culture, lifestyle, and environment. This section explores how Malaysian research compares to global studies, highlighting key differences and actionable insights.

What Sets Malaysia Apart

Malaysia’s tropical climate might suggest ample sunlight exposure, yet deficiencies remain prevalent. Studies show that 63.9% of adults in Kuala Lumpur have insufficient levels, compared to 75% in Saudi Arabia’s Eastern region. This disparity underscores the role of cultural practices, such as traditional clothing, which limit skin exposure.

Urban lifestyles also play a significant role. In Malaysia, 78.9% of adolescents aged 12–13 have low levels, a trend mirrored in urban populations worldwide. However, Malaysia’s unique blend of dietary habits and environmental factors creates a distinct health landscape.

“The link between lifestyle and nutrient levels is undeniable. Addressing these factors requires culturally sensitive interventions.”

Key Differences in Environmental and Dietary Factors

Global studies highlight varying patterns of deficiency. For example, in Turkey, 47.5% of elderly populations face deficiencies, while in the USA, low levels persist despite abundant sunlight. In contrast, Malaysia’s urban women average 24.4 nmol/L, significantly lower than rural counterparts.

Dietary habits also differ. Malaysian children consume only 25% of the recommended calcium intake, compared to higher rates in Western countries. This, combined with limited sun exposure, creates a unique challenge for bone health.

RegionDeficiency RateKey Insight
Malaysia63.9% (Adults)Urban lifestyles and cultural practices
Saudi Arabia75% (Eastern Region)High prevalence despite sunny climate
Turkey47.5% (Elderly)Age-related decline in nutrient levels

The Importance of Calcium and Other Minerals for Bone Density

Maintaining strong bones requires more than just calcium; it’s a symphony of essential nutrients working together. These nutrients play a vital role in enhancing mineral density and preventing bone-related conditions. Understanding their synergy can help individuals make informed dietary choices for long-term health.

Synergy Between Calcium and Vitamin D

Calcium is the cornerstone of bone health, but its effectiveness depends on another key nutrient. This nutrient helps the body absorb calcium efficiently, ensuring it reaches the bones. Without this synergy, calcium cannot be utilized properly, leading to weakened mineral density.

Research shows that individuals with adequate levels of both nutrients have stronger bones and a lower risk of fractures. For example, consuming dairy products fortified with these nutrients can significantly improve bone health. This combination is especially important for older adults and women, who are more prone to bone-related diseases.

Other Essential Micronutrients

Beyond calcium and its partner, other micronutrients are crucial for maintaining bone health. Magnesium, for instance, supports bone structure by aiding in calcium absorption. Vitamin K plays a role in bone mineralization, ensuring calcium is deposited where it’s needed most.

Zinc is another essential nutrient that promotes bone growth and repair. A deficiency in any of these micronutrients can compromise bone strength and increase the risk of diseases like osteoporosis. Including a variety of nutrient-rich foods in your diet is key to preventing such conditions.

NutrientRole in Bone HealthFood Sources
CalciumBuilds bone structureMilk, cheese, tofu
MagnesiumSupports calcium absorptionNuts, seeds, leafy greens
Vitamin KAids in bone mineralizationBroccoli, spinach, kale
ZincPromotes bone growthMeat, shellfish, legumes
